Electrician Certificate, Diploma and Degree Programs near Shamokin PA

Shamokin PA electrician re-wiring power outletThere are multiple approaches to get electrician training in a vocational or trade school near Shamokin PA. You may choose a certificate or diploma program, or receive an Associate Degree. Bachelor’s Degrees are offered at some schools, but are not as common as the other three options. Often these programs are offered together with an apprenticeship program, which are required by most states to become licensed or if you intend to earn certification. Bellow are short explanations of the 3 most prevalent programs available.

  • Diploma and Certificate Programs are typically provided by Pennsylvania technical and trade schools and take about a year to complete. They provide a solid foundation and are aimed towards individuals who want to enter an apprenticeship more quickly as a journeyman electrician.
  • Associate Degree Programs take 2 years to finish and are provided by Pennsylvania junior or community colleges, typically as an Associate Degree in Electrical Technology. They offer a more extensive education while providing the foundation that readies students to join their apprenticeship program.

As previously mentioned, Bachelor’s Degrees are offered at certain Pennsylvania colleges, but are less preferred at 4 years than the other briefer programs. The majority of states require that an apprenticeship of no less than 2 years and in most cases 4 years be performed prior to licensing. Therefore, the majority of students are eager to commence their paid apprenticeship, especially if it’s not a component of their academic program.

Electrician License and Certification Criteria

Shamokin PA electricians working on power linesElectricians in Shamokin PA can carry out a wide range of services, including installing, replacing and testing electrical systems, and ensuring that the wiring in houses and buildings are up to code standards. After finishing an apprenticeship, journeyman electricians are mandated to become licensed in most states or municipalities. The duration of apprenticeship varies by state, but typically about four to five years of experience is required in order to take the licensing exam. The exams commonly test electrical theory and general knowledge, in addition to understanding of the National Electrical Code (NEC). Receiving certification is also a voluntary method for an electrician to differentiate him or herself as a skilled and experienced professional. The certifications offered vary by state and may be obtained in numerous specialties, such as cable splicing as an example. The certification procedure in most cases involves three levels of competency:

  • An experience requirement
  • Passing a written exam
  • Passing a practical exam

Examples of certifying agencies include the National Joint Apprenticeship and Training Committee (NJATC) along with the National Institute for Certification in Engineering Technologies (NICET). Attending Electrician Training Classes Online in Shamokin PA

attending electrician school online in Shamokin PAAn option that you may have contemplated is enrolling in an electrician online school to earn a certificate or degree. Although online schools have become more accepted as a way of attending class without needing to travel, in this instance they are not totally internet based. Pretty much all electrician training programs require some attendance on-campus to get practical hands-on training. But since the rest of the classes may be attended online, internet learning may be a more accommodating choice for students that have minimal time for education. And as an added benefit many online degree programs have a lower tuition cost compared to their traditional counterparts. Travelling costs from Shamokin PA are also minimized and some of the study materials can be accessed on line as well. All of these benefits can make online electrician vocational schools more affordable and convenient. And many are fully accredited, which we will deal with in our due diligence checklist.

Accreditation.  Many electrician technical programs have received either a regional or a national accreditation. They may receive Institutional Accreditation, which focuses on the school’s programs as a whole, or Programmatic Accreditation, which pertains to a specific program, for instance electrical technology. Verify that the Shamokin PA program is accredited by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ged accrediting organization, which includes the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. Along with helping guarantee that you obtain a quality education, it can help in securing financial assistance or student loans, which are in many cases not available for non-accredited schools. Additionally, some states mandate that the electrician training program be accredited in order to be approved for licensing.

High Completion and Placement Rates.  Ask the electrician training programs you are considering what their completion rates are. The completion rate is the portion or percentage of students who enroll in and complete the program. A lower completion rate may suggest that students were disappointed with the program and quit. It may also signify that the instructors were not competent to train the students. It’s also important that the schools have higher job placement rates. Older and/or more reputable schools may have a more extensive directory of graduates, which may produce more contacts for the school to use for their apprenticeship and job placement programs. A high job placement rate can not only validate that the school has a good reputation within the trade, but also that it has the network of contacts to assist Shamokin PA graduates secure apprenticeships or employment.

Shamokin, Pennsylvania

Shamokin (/ʃəˈmoʊkɪn/; Saponi Algonquian Schahamokink, meaning "place of eels") (Lenape Indian language: Shahëmokink [3]) is a city in Northumberland County, Pennsylvania, surrounded by Coal Township at the western edge of the Anthracite Coal Region in central Pennsylvania. It was named after a Saponi Indian village, Schahamokink. At the 2010 decennial United States Census, the population was 7,374 residents. Approximately half what it was at the mid-century mark total in 1950. The city of Shamokin is bordered by Coal Township, Pennsylvania.

The first human settlement of Shamokin was probably Shawnee natives migrants.[4] A large population of Delaware Indians (also known as the Lenapes) were also forcibly resettled there in the early 18th century after they lost rights to their land in the "Walking Purchase" (also known as the "Walking Treaty") along the eastern border of the colonial Province of Pennsylvania in the upper northern reaches of the Delaware River in 1737. Canasatego of the Six Nations, enforcing the Walking Purchase on behalf of George Thomas, Deputy Governor of Pennsylvania (1738-1747), ordered the Delaware Indians to go to two places on the Susquehanna River, one of which was present-day Sunbury on the river at the forks.[4]

From 1727 to 1756, Sunbury on the east bank of the Susquehanna, was one of the largest and most influential Indian settlements in Pennsylvania.[4] At that time, it was known as "Shamokin", not to be confused with the present-day city of Shamokin, Pennsylvania, which is located to the east. In 1745, Presbyterian missionary David Brainerd described the town as being located on both the east and west sides of the river, and on an island, as well. Brainerd reported that the city housed 300 Indians, half of which were Delawares and the other Seneca and Tutelo.[5]
